Trading Standards Report Estate Agents Must Disclose Referral Fees

Today a Trading Standard Report states that over 80% of estate agents have received a referral fee from parties involved in the home buying and selling process including conveyancing firms.  In a majority of cases these referral fees are not disclosed to the consumer.
